FAQs for booking flights from Boston to Mississauga

  • Which airports will I be using when flying from Boston to Mississauga?

    When flying out of Boston you’ll be using Boston Logan Intl. Mississauga does not have its own airport so you’ll be flying into nearby Toronto Pearson Intl airport, which is 6.3 mi away.

  • How long does a flight from Boston to Mississauga take?

    Direct flights cover the 444 miles separating Boston and Mississauga in about 2h 02m.

  • How many flights are there between Boston and Mississauga?

    12 direct flights run between Boston and Mississauga on a daily basis. On average, there are about 88 departures each week.

  • What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ly between Boston and Mississauga?

    Consider leaving on a Thursday and avoid Tuesdays if you are looking for the best rates. For your return to Boston, you’ll find the best rates on Wednesdays and the most expensive ones on Fridays.

Top tips for finding cheap flights from Boston to Mississauga

  • There is no airport in Mississauga. Instead, you’ll be flying into Toronto Pearson Airport when flying between Boston and Mississauga.
  • The cheapest flight from Boston to Mississauga was found 76 days before departure, on average.
  • Book at least 2 weeks before departure in order to get a below-average price.
  • High season is considered to be October, November and December. The cheapest month to fly is March.
